Chapter 629: Chapter 629: Seeking Qiao Yun Unpleasantly, Ended up Furious Chapter 629: Chapter 629: Seeking Qiao Yun Unpleasantly, Ended up Furious Qiao Yun finally understood where Qin Xuan’s malice towards her came from after hearing these words.

She glanced at Qin Xuan indifferently and sincerely asked, “Are you threatening me?”

Qin Xuan arrogantly responded, “Yes, I am threatening you.”

Qiao Yun’s expression remained calm, but her words infuriated Qin Xuan, “Without me, he wouldn’t like you either.”

Qin Xuan was choked by her straightforward statement, and unwillingly said, “How do you know he wouldn’t like me without you? As long as you’re not around, Brother Han Zhou would turn his attention to me, and he would be able to see my worth.”

Qiao Yun thought to herself, she wasn’t foolish, it was clear that Han Zhou didn’t like Qin Xuan.

So, hearing Qin Xuan’s words, she didn’t react much.

Instead, Qin Xuan was frustrated by her indifferent attitude. Being a member of the Qin family, wherever she went, she was the center of adoration.

Qiao Yun, just a minor miss from the Lu Family, dared to ignore her threat.

She laughed angrily, “Right now, you’re just relying on Brother Han Zhou to act all high and mighty. That’s your goal, isn’t it? To rise with the tide through Han Zhou.”

Qiao Yun stated truthfully, “No, it’s through me that he can survive; he needs me.”

Qin Xuan was stunned for a moment, then burst out laughing, “You really are shameless.”

Qiao Yun took a sip of her juice, expressionless, thinking that although she was always telling the truth, no one believed her.

They only believe when faced with the facts.

Alas…

Qin Xuan calmed down a bit and continued to provoke, “Alright, even if Brother Han Zhou really likes you, does your family background match up to him? Only my family background is worthy of Brother Han Zhou.”

Qiao Yun looked at her with pity, “The fact is, he doesn’t need you to be worthy.”

Qiao Yun wasn’t much of a talker, and she usually ignored nuisances like fleas that came before her.

Because she didn’t need others’ approval, she didn’t want to waste time on these people.

But strangely enough, Qin Xuan, who came before her declaring her sovereignty, just looked displeasing to her no matter how she looked.

Qin Xuan was choked again but quickly convinced herself that this person must be feeling inferior. Otherwise, why wouldn’t she refute her about the family background issue?

Thinking this, Qin Xuan felt much better, and her next words were even more sarcastic, “So you do know that your family background doesn’t match up to Brother Han Zhou. Pretty self-aware, aren’t you?”

Qiao Yun maintained her cold demeanor, “If you say so.”

Qin Xuan laughed and leisurely said, “Let me tell you the truth, you’ll never get to marry into the Li Family in your life. Did you know? Grandfather Li intends for me and Brother Han Zhou to enter into a matrimonial alliance. Do you think Brother Han Zhou would go against his own grandfather for you?”

She scrutinized Qiao Yun from head to toe, her eyes nearly spelling out the words, “You’re not worthy!”

Qiao Yun’s face showed no change, but her brows furrowed slightly.

Was this matrimonial alliance real?

After bickering with Qiao Yun for so long and finally seeing a change on Qiao Yun’s face, Qin Xuan’s gloomy mood lifted a bit, and she deliberately said, “I’m not in a hurry; after all, the person who will end up with Brother Han Zhou is me.”

Qiao Yun restrained her expression and said flatly, “He doesn’t like you.”

Qin Xuan hated hearing this sentence the most, she said through gritted teeth, “But the person who will marry him is me!”

Qiao Yun nodded, “Hmm, but he doesn’t like you.”

“So, does he truly love you, then?”

“Oh, he doesn’t like you though.”

“Brother Han Zhou is just playing with you. You better understand your place!”

“Well, he still doesn’t like you anyway.”

Qin Xuan: “…”

Qin Xuan, green in the face with rage, nearly flipped the table on the spot.

Are you deliberately doing this or what!

Qiao Yun saw that she had stopped pressing and asked, “You finally understand that he doesn’t like you?”

Qin Xuan: “…”

Qin Xuan painfully clutched her chest. Even though Qiao Yun had neither quarreled with her nor fought with her, she was infuriated to death.

What an annoying way to infuriate someone, she would rather have Qiao Yun mock her outright than be angered like this.

It was like punching into cotton, making her feel like a monkey jumping around and putting on a show.

Qiao Yun didn’t know what Qin Xuan was thinking; she truly believed it to be the case.

Qin Xuan took a deep breath, “Fine, very well, it’s the first time someone dares to provoke me like this.”

Qiao Yun puzzledly thought, “When did I provoke Qin Xuan?” It had clearly been Qin Xuan who had always been provoking her.

Even without her presence, Li Hanzhou wouldn’t like Qin Xuan. She had only tolerated Qin Xuan’s incessant chatter out of pity for her.

Seeing her so infuriated, Qiao Yun kindly suggested, “If you think I’m provoking you, you shouldn’t talk to me.”

Qin Xuan reflected on herself upon hearing these words.

Maybe she shouldn’t have talked to Qiao Yun at all.

Dealing with someone so impervious was simply masochistic. Why should she make herself miserable?

Qin Xuan was very angry, but she was helpless because Qiao Yun simply wouldn’t look her in the eye.

So, she bitterly said, “I’ll bet with you to see who gets the last laugh, and whom Li Hanzhou will ultimately choose!”

Li Hanzhou just hadn’t seen her merits yet, and he wasn’t aware of the benefits of marrying into the Qin Family.

Once he understood these, he would definitely choose to be with her.

Qiao Yun remained unmoved, “Who he chooses is his business, but he doesn’t like you.”

Qin Xuan: “…”

Is this damn thing a vicious cycle!?

Qin Xuan couldn’t control the twisted expression on her face. If she could, she would have loved to tear apart Qiao Yun’s composed demeanor.

Luckily, the last bit of her sanity told her that this was not the place to cause a scene.

“What are you doing?” Qin Yuan came over, his glance at Qin Xuan neither warm nor cold, “Mom is looking for you.”

Qin Xuan sneered, thinking he should not act as if she didn’t know his intentions. Why show up now to play the hero?

She was quite sensible, giving Qin Yuan face, stood up, and fiercely glared at Qiao Yun before finally walking away in her high heels.

She had underestimated Qiao Yun. Just wait, she wasn’t going to let it go at that.

“Sorry, Qin Xuan has been spoiled since she was young. Are you alright?” Qin Yuan, smiling, his gaze subtly evaluating Qiao Yun.

Qiao Yun, disliking the smile on his face, answered coldly, “I’m fine.”

Qin Yuan continued, “That’s good. You haven’t answered my question just now.”

Qiao Yun looked up: ?

“May I invite you for a dance?”

Qiao Yun curled her lips and bluntly said, “No.”

Qin Yuan’s smile slightly faded, but he quickly regained his composure. He noticed Qiao Yun’s impatience.

He thought, perhaps she was taking her anger out on him?

Annoyed by Qin Xuan’s interference, he murmured.

“I have another matter to attend to, please excuse me.” He knew when to retreat gracefully, maintaining a distance that wouldn’t cause others’ displeasure.

Qiao Yun was momentarily stunned, not expecting him to leave so promptly. Was her intuition wrong?
